Top 5 Disney Games Performance in Chile During Q4 2023
Discover the performance metrics of the top 5 Disney games in Chile for Q4 2023, including downloads, revenue, and active user trends.
In the fourth quarter of 2023, the top 5 Disney games on a unified platform in Chile showcased varying performance trends in terms of down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. Here’s a detailed look at each game's metrics, based on data from Sensor Tower.
MARVEL SNAP saw a notable increase in revenue, peaking at approximately $8.6K in the week of November 6. Downloads fluctuated, with a high of around 3K in mid-October and a low of 543 in mid-December. Weekly active users experienced a peak of 14.9K in mid-October, gradually decreasing to 11K by the end of December.
Disney Magic Kingdoms had a steady revenue stream, reaching around $339 in early October and ending the quarter at about $174. Downloads spiked to 5.2K in mid-November but generally ranged between 609 and 2.1K. The game’s weekly active users surged to 6.3K in mid-November before stabilizing around 3.7K by the end of December.
The Simpsons™: Tapped Out experienced a significant revenue increase to $4.7K in mid-November, with downloads peaking at 2.6K in late November. Weekly active users remained relatively stable, fluctuating around 13K to 14K throughout the quarter.
Marvel Contest of Champions showed strong performance in revenue, peaking at $15.9K in mid-December. Downloads varied, with a high of 2.5K in mid-November. Weekly active users saw a peak of 6.5K in late November, maintaining a steady trend around 4.3K to 6.5K.
LEGO® Star Wars™ - TFA had modest revenue, peaking at $63 in mid-November. Downloads were highest at 2.2K in the last week of December. Weekly active users saw a gradual increase, reaching 4.4K by the end of the quarter.
